The War on Drugs Share Strangely Sweet “Nothing to Find” Video, Starring IT‘s Sophia Lillis

Still riding the momentum from the recent release of their acclaimed fourth album A Deeper Understanding, The War on Drugs have shared the video for “Nothing to Find,” starring young actress Sophia Lillis (of IT fame), who embarks on a road trip with some sort of plant man.

Directed by Ben Fee, the offbeat video “presents the bittersweet story of two friends on a not-so-classic road trip adventure,” per a press release, following Lillis’ character and Plant Man as they commit petty theft, commune with nature, shoot pool and have a dance party, until eventually Plant Man falls ill and returns to the earth. For all its sweetness, the video is awfully sobering: Whether plant or person, we all have our time, it reminds us—or as Adam Granduciel sings, “There is nothing I can do if I am going away.” But the video’s closing moments, which we won’t spoil for you here, offer a glimmer of hope for what we may find in the hereafter.

The War on Drugs recently wrapped up their first North American tour in support of A Deeper Understanding, and they’ll follow it up with a November trip across the pond for a series of mostly sold-out European shows before returning to the States for a brief run in December.
